The Company said it has purchased the new 1999 and 2000 model year tractors from Freightliner Corporation. These units will replace 400 older units and will reduce significantly the average age of the tractor fleet. The balance of the units will increase the fleet, in response to demand for the Company's services in the north-south lane, between Canada, the U.S. and Mexico. Additionally, the Company is taking delivery of 1,300 new 53' air-ride trailers. These units will be leased from TIP, Inc., a GE Capital Company, and are being built by Ramirez Trailer Corporation of Monterrey, Mexico. These units will replace older units in the fleet.
